Program areas at Widowed Persons Association of California Inc- Sacramento Chapter 1
Activities for members including dances, outing to the theatre, day trips to surrounding area attractions, holiday parties, and other events are organized for the purpose of introducing Widowed Persons to new friends and helping to connect Widowed Persons with similar interests. These events are the primary method used to provide therapy for the Widowed person through the social interaction with others that have experienced loss. Social events are scheduled to assist in the transition from bereavement to social activities. Smaller events such as bowling, golf, card games, and dances occur weekly, and there are three major events year at halloween, christmas and st. patrick's day.
Monthly luncheons provide the Widowed Persons Association of California, inc. an opportunity to reach out to new members, announce upcoming events, handle organizational business, and make members aware of the available services offered. The luncheons are the first introduction to the organization to many newly Widowed Persons and offer a great venue for getting to know some members in a non-threatening environment.
Recovery programs are provided to help Widowed Persons throughout California cope with the loss of a spouse or a loved one and encourage Widowed people to live full lives following the death of a spouse or loved one. Widowed Persons Association of California, inc. offers the following recovery programs; counselling is available by member request on an ongoing basis; grief support groups are held every sunday throughout the year for members; and members learn how to cope and address common issues at grief workshops four times per year and grief discussion groups that are ongoing with regular training programs for facilitators.
